Output 66934e0d25db971e0e331011ef8f2edd8bb01acdfcb95790576007fbf376a68b:0

value
1678954
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39a95c5046c628b40e9214bef0cc442b7802f5e1 OP_EQUAL
address
36wuKrmUnQVUWfRCzwhobpHxM8pY1yeH8c
transaction
66934e0d25db971e0e331011ef8f2edd8bb01acdfcb95790576007fbf376a68b
spent
true